logo

合合信息:基于文本纠错技术优化OCR任务准确率的实践探索

作者:暴富20212025.09.19 12:56浏览量:0

简介:本文聚焦合合信息如何通过文本纠错技术提升OCR识别准确率,从技术原理、纠错策略、多场景适配及行业价值四个维度展开,结合工程化实践与效果评估,为OCR技术优化提供可复用的解决方案。

合合信息:基于文本纠错技术优化OCR任务准确率的实践探索

一、OCR识别准确率的核心挑战与文本纠错的必要性

OCR(光学字符识别)技术作为文档数字化、信息提取的核心工具,其识别准确率直接影响下游业务(如合同审核、票据处理、档案归档)的效率与质量。然而,实际应用中,OCR识别结果常因以下因素产生错误:

  1. 图像质量问题:模糊、倾斜、光照不均、背景干扰(如手写笔记覆盖印刷体)导致字符分割错误;
  2. 字体与排版复杂性:艺术字体、多语言混排、复杂版式(如表格嵌套)增加识别难度;
  3. 语义上下文缺失:孤立字符识别易混淆形似字(如“日”与“目”、“未”与“末”),或忽略逻辑约束(如日期格式“2023/13/05”)。

传统OCR系统多依赖字符级分类模型,对上下文信息的利用不足,导致纠错能力受限。合合信息通过引入文本纠错技术,构建“识别-纠错-验证”的闭环流程,显著提升了OCR在复杂场景下的准确率。

二、合合信息文本纠错技术的核心方法

1. 多模态融合的纠错框架

合合信息采用“图像+文本”双模态纠错策略,结合视觉特征与语言模型:

  • 视觉层纠错:通过分析字符的笔画结构、连通域特征,识别断裂、粘连等图像缺陷。例如,对模糊字符“氵”与“冫”的区分,基于笔画连续性模型进行修正;
  • 语言层纠错:集成预训练语言模型(如BERT、GPT),结合业务领域知识库,对识别结果进行语义合理性校验。例如,在金融票据场景中,若OCR识别出“金额:壹佰万圆整”,但上下文存在“折扣率:80%”,则触发金额计算逻辑校验。

2. 动态纠错规则引擎

针对不同业务场景,合合信息构建了可配置的纠错规则库:

  • 正则表达式匹配:定义格式约束(如身份证号、日期、电话号码),过滤非法字符组合;
  • 领域词典约束:加载行业术语库(如医学、法律),对专业词汇进行强制匹配;
  • 上下文关联规则:例如,在合同场景中,若检测到“甲方:XXX公司”后紧跟“乙方:”,则强制要求下一行出现有效公司名称。

3. 增量学习与自适应优化

合合信息通过持续收集用户反馈与纠错日志,动态更新纠错模型:

  • 错误模式挖掘:统计高频错误类型(如“部”与“陪”、“已”与“己”),针对性强化训练;
  • 模型微调:基于少量标注数据,使用LoRA(Low-Rank Adaptation)技术快速适配新场景;
  • A/B测试验证:并行运行新旧纠错策略,通过准确率、召回率、处理时效等指标评估效果。

三、工程化实践与效果评估

1. 纠错流程的工程实现

合合信息将文本纠错嵌入OCR流水线,优化计算效率:

  1. # 伪代码:OCR纠错流水线示例
  2. def ocr_with_correction(image):
  3. # 1. 基础OCR识别
  4. raw_text = ocr_engine.recognize(image)
  5. # 2. 视觉层纠错(并行处理)
  6. visual_corrected = visual_corrector.process(raw_text, image)
  7. # 3. 语言层纠错(串行处理)
  8. semantic_corrected = language_corrector.process(visual_corrected)
  9. # 4. 规则引擎校验
  10. final_text = rule_engine.validate(semantic_corrected)
  11. return final_text

通过异步任务队列与缓存机制,实现高并发场景下的低延迟响应。

2. 实际场景效果对比

在某银行票据处理项目中,合合信息的纠错技术使OCR准确率从92.3%提升至98.7%:
| 错误类型 | 纠错前错误率 | 纠错后错误率 | 纠错方法 |
|————————|———————|———————|———————————————|
| 形似字混淆 | 4.2% | 0.8% | 视觉特征+语言模型联合决策 |
| 格式错误 | 2.1% | 0.3% | 正则表达式+领域词典 |
| 逻辑不一致 | 1.7% | 0.1% | 上下文关联规则+计算校验 |

四、行业价值与未来方向

合合信息的文本纠错技术已广泛应用于金融、医疗、政务等领域,其核心价值在于:

  1. 降低人工复核成本:减少80%以上的人工校验工作量;
  2. 提升业务合规性:避免因OCR错误导致的合同纠纷、财务风控问题;
  3. 支持复杂文档处理:如手写体与印刷体混排、多语言文档的精准识别。

未来,合合信息将探索以下方向:

  • 轻量化模型部署:通过模型剪枝与量化,适配边缘设备;
  • 多语言纠错扩展:构建跨语言语义理解能力,支持全球业务;
  • 实时纠错反馈:结合AR技术,在扫描过程中即时提示修正建议。

结语

文本纠错技术是OCR从“可用”到“可靠”的关键跃迁。合合信息通过多模态融合、动态规则引擎与增量学习,构建了高适应性的纠错体系,为OCR技术在垂直领域的深度落地提供了标杆实践。对于开发者而言,借鉴其分层纠错策略与工程优化方法,可快速提升自有OCR系统的鲁棒性;对于企业用户,选择具备纠错能力的OCR服务,能显著降低数字化过程中的风险与成本。

相关文章推荐

发表评论